[QUOTE="GelatinousPig, post: 1322720, member: 93689"] holy crap, i just ran the numbers for 2000fps (estimated for the grendel) and the darn thing would still be supersonic at 1000yds. i was just joking about loading up for it, but on a dead calm day that might actually be interesting. [edit] used Litz's numbers from his very informative post found elsewhere on this site covering (.630 g1), and it dropped to 925yds, but i'm still floored at what these guys can do in theory.
